The money that was stolen from the Town of Poughkeepsie, N.Y. on January 12 has been restored.
"With the help of its bank, Cherry Hill, N.J.-based TD Bank, and law enforcement authorities, all of the $378,470 stolen by cybercriminals earlier this year has been restored," writes SearchFinancialSecurity.com's Marcia Savage.
"Myers had criticized TD Bank for not catching the unauthorized transfers, but with the restoration of the funds, she praised the bank for 'its professional response to the situation' and said the town is happy to have 'a banking partner that works hard to identify ways to help customers protect their money,'" Savage writes.
